Tata Motors has officially launched the Tata Harrier EV 2025. It is the company’s most premium electric SUV yet. Built on the advanced acti.ev+ platform, the Harrier EV promises power, technology, and long range. It is aimed at urban buyers looking for a stylish and high-performance electric SUV in India.

Quick Specs Table: Tata Harrier EV 2025
Feature | Specification |
---|---|
Battery Options | 65 kWh / 75 kWh |
Motor Setup | RWD / Dual Motor AWD |
Power Output | Up to 393 PS |
Torque | 504 Nm |
Range (Real-World) | 480–505 km |
MIDC Certified Range | Up to 627 km |
Acceleration (0–100 km/h) | 6.3 seconds (Boost Mode) |
Charging Time (DC) | 20–80% in 25 minutes |
Safety | 7 airbags, Level 2 ADAS, ESC |
Infotainment | 14.5” QLED screen, Harman Kardon Audio |
Price (Ex-Showroom India) | ₹21.49 lakh to ₹28+ lakh (estimated) |
Bold Design with EV Identity

The new Harrier EV 2025 shares its base design with the regular Harrier SUV. However, it gets several updates that give it a unique electric identity.
- Closed-off front grille for better aerodynamics
- Full-width LED light bars at front and rear
- Stylish new dual-tone 19-inch alloy wheels
- ‘.EV’ badges on the tailgate and doors
- A special Stealth Edition with matte paint finish
The SUV is 4,607 mm long, has a wheelbase of 2,741 mm, and is slightly wider than its diesel version. The design is futuristic yet familiar, making it attractive for Indian buyers.

Plush and Tech-Packed Interior
Step inside the Harrier EV, and you’ll be greeted by a premium and high-tech cabin. It is modern, comfortable, and loaded with features.
Highlights include:
- Massive 14.5-inch QLED touchscreen with Tata’s next-gen UI
- 12.3-inch fully digital instrument cluster
- 10-speaker Harman Kardon audio system
- Dual-zone automatic climate control
- Panoramic sunroof and ventilated front seats
- Memory function for driver seat
- 540-degree surround view camera with park assist
- Wireless phone charging and multiple USB ports
- Multi-mood ambient lighting and Boss Mode for rear seat comfort
The overall layout is clean, elegant, and made with soft-touch materials. Tata has clearly positioned the Harrier EV as a luxury electric SUV in India.
Powerful Battery and Drive Options
The Tata Harrier EV 2025 is available with two battery packs:
- 65 kWh battery
- 75 kWh battery
There are also two motor configurations:
- Single motor rear-wheel drive (RWD)
- Power: 235 PS
- Torque: 504 Nm
- Range: Around 480–505 km (real-world)
- Acceleration: 0–100 km/h in about 8 seconds
- Dual motor all-wheel drive (AWD)
- Power: Up to 393 PS (combined)
- Torque: 504 Nm
- Boost Mode: 0–100 km/h in just 6.3 seconds
- MIDC Certified Range: Up to 627 km
This makes the Harrier EV one of the most powerful Tata EVs yet, and a strong rival to upcoming electric SUVs like the Mahindra XUV.e9 and Hyundai Creta EV.
Smart Charging and Energy Features
The Harrier EV offers fast charging and energy-sharing features that improve practicality:
- 120 kW DC fast charging
- 20–80% charge in about 25 minutes
- Up to 250 km of range added in 15 minutes
- V2L (Vehicle to Load) and V2V (Vehicle to Vehicle) charging support
- Wallbox AC charger provided with the car
These features allow the SUV to power external devices or even charge other EVs in emergencies.
Safety and ADAS Features
Tata Motors has packed the Harrier EV 2025 with modern safety technology:
- Level 2 ADAS
- Adaptive cruise control
- Lane-keeping assist
- Blind-spot monitoring
- Emergency braking
- Rear cross-traffic alert
- 7 airbags
- Electronic Stability Control (ESC)
- Hill-start assist and descent control
- Electronic parking brake
- High-strength steel body structure
- Expected 5-star Bharat NCAP rating
These features make the Harrier EV one of the safest electric SUVs for Indian roads.
Terrain Modes and Off-Road Capabilities
Unlike most EVs, the Harrier EV is also built for rough roads:
- AWD versions offer better grip and control on bad roads
- Multi-terrain drive modes: Normal, Snow, Sand, Mud, Rock-Crawl
- Custom mode for personalised driving setup
- Ground clearance is similar to the ICE Harrier, giving it confidence off-road
The Harrier EV even managed to climb Kerala’s famous Elephant Rock during testing—showing its power and grip in real conditions.
Tata Harrier EV Price in India and Variants
The Harrier EV price in India starts at ₹21.49 lakh (ex-showroom). It is available in four trims:
- Adventure – Base variant (RWD)
- Fearless – Mid variant with more features
- Empowered – High-end trim with AWD option
- Stealth Edition – Special matte black version with visual upgrades
Top-end variants may cost over ₹28 lakh (on-road), especially with dual motor AWD.
